/**
* Interface for State design pattern.
* <p>
* Isolates can be in different states due to events within/outside the control of the developer.
* This pattern allows us to extract out the state related behaviour without maintaining it all in
* the JavaScriptIsolate class which proved to be error-prone and hard to read.
* <p>
* State specific behaviour are implemented in concrete classes that implements this interface.
* <p>
* Refer: https://en.wikipedia.org/wiki/State_pattern
*/
interface IsolateState {
@NonNull
ListenableFuture<String> evaluateJavaScriptAsync(@NonNull String code);
@NonNull
ListenableFuture<String> evaluateJavaScriptAsync(@NonNull AssetFileDescriptor afd);
@NonNull
ListenableFuture<String> evaluateJavaScriptAsync(@NonNull ParcelFileDescriptor pfd);
void setConsoleCallback(@NonNull Executor executor,
@NonNull JavaScriptConsoleCallback callback);
void setConsoleCallback(@NonNull JavaScriptConsoleCallback callback);
void clearConsoleCallback();
void provideNamedData(@NonNull String name, @NonNull byte[] inputBytes);
void close();
/**
* Check whether the current state is permitted to transition to a dead state
*
* @return true iff a transition to a dead state is permitted.
*/
boolean canDie();
/**
* Method to run after this state has been replaced by a dead state.
*
* @param terminationInfo The termination info describing the death.
*/
default void onDied(@NonNull TerminationInfo terminationInfo) {}
void addOnTerminatedCallback(@NonNull Executor executor,
@NonNull Consumer<TerminationInfo> callback);
void removeOnTerminatedCallback(@NonNull Consumer<TerminationInfo> callback);
}
